Changelog (eng sync) — TideSlip widget 1.9: Renamed TIDE_KEY to TIDETABLE_FEED_SECRET. Old name deprecated now, removed in 2.0. Reason: collision with the harbor-cam integration's var of the same name, which caused the Port Averill outage last week. Action items: update all env files before Friday's cut; CI will fail builds still using the old name; docs updated. No value change, rename only. For reference, the correct replacement line as it should appear in each environment file follows:

vault entry, bagep-yahip: VAULT_KEY8=d2a227e5

Subject: Kiosk watchdog cut-over complete

Hello plugin authors,

The cut-over of the Marlow kiosk fleet to the new watchdog finished last night. The old heartbeat shim is retired; the watchdog now restarts any kiosk process that misses three consecutive pings, and plugins are given a grace window to flush state before termination. If your plugin performs long blocking work, emit progress pings or you will be restarted. No plugin code changes are required otherwise. For reference, the watchdog now runs with the following configuration.

service settings:
HOLDOR_PIN=6477
HOLDOR_METRICS_HOST=metrics.holdor.nelvrocorp.corp
HOLDOR_LOG_LEVEL=error
HOLDOR_TENANT=noviel

Q: How realistic is the Liftwright dispatch simulator, and can I trust its numbers?

A: Pretty realistic for morning-peak scenarios — it was tuned against real traffic from the Harrowgate tower pilot. Off-peak behavior is rougher, so don't cite those wait times in client decks. Passenger arrival models, car kinematics, and the scenario file format all have their quirks worth knowing before you run your first batch. The full simulator guide lives on the internal page below.

wiki page, tahaf-tajog: https://jira.ordindyn.corp/pipeline

### Checklist: static-analysis baseline

- Confirm `lintbase.json` in the Tarnwell repo matches the frozen baseline from sprint close. No new suppressions may be added after freeze.
- Any diff against the baseline requires sign-off from the Harrowgate security desk before tag.
- Run the Quillscan comparator in strict mode; warnings count as failures.
- Attach the comparator report to the release ticket. Record the scan's trace token directly beneath this item.

pipeline stamp: htk6_35e0c9